http://www.freshlypreservedideas.com/ WebBy Charlotte King. Pickle Crisp is a brand name for food-grade calcium chloride made by the Ball company. It is mainly used as a firming agent for canning pickles and other fruits and vegetables. It’s a convenient and easy-to-use product that replaces the process of soaking produce for hours.
